2008 Jeep Cherokee vs. 2002 Volvo V70

To start off, 2008 Jeep Cherokee is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Volvo V70.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Volvo V70 would be higher. At 2,776 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Jeep Cherokee is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Jeep Cherokee (148 HP @ 3800 RPM) has 10 more horse power than 2002 Volvo V70. (138 HP @ 6100 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Jeep Cherokee should accelerate faster than 2002 Volvo V70.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Jeep Cherokee weights approximately 551 kg more than 2002 Volvo V70.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 Jeep Cherokee is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2002 Volvo V70.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Jeep Cherokee will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Jeep Cherokee (360 Nm @ 1800 RPM) has 140 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Volvo V70. (220 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2008 Jeep Cherokee will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Volvo V70.
